Farncombe Youth Football Club (formerly Farncombe Boys) was formed in 1975 to provide the opportunity for competitive football for youngsters.
The Club has grown to just under 400 members with 26 teams, and now provides the opportunity for competitive league football from U8's to 17 years of age. Our U7's play friendly football, and we have a Nursery Squad for rising 5's to train and learn the basics of football.
Regular weekly training is available from August through to end of April, and is then topped off with our Inhouse tournament for all members and our Annual Tournament, which hosts just under 150 football teams in one weekend.
We are an FA Charter Standard Club, to which we have to meet various requirements from the FA.
We offer Football for All, and currently have 3 girls teams.

Previous players include:
Mark Hudson - Crystal Palace
John Humphrey - Leatherhead & Millwall
Iain Hendry - Crystal Palace, Wycombe Wanderers YT
Stuart Girdler - Woking
Many players have progressed and become professional or semi professional, many others still play senior or junior football in this area.
All children are welcome of all abilities.
We play in red & blue tops, navy shorts & socks. We also have a white away kit available.
